Tertiary Options and Opportunities Fair
posted (January 31, 2018)
If you are not sure which university to go to after high school or where the funding will come from, you would have surely benefited from today's Tertiary Options and Opportunities Fair. It was held at the St. Catherine's Academy Auditorium in Belize City. A number of US Colleges and Universities along with our local institutions had booths at the fair. Here's more:

Deryck Satchwell, Deputy Director, Tertiary and Post-Secondary Education Service
"This is a tertiary options an opportunities education expo. It is intended to have students particularly those who are at the secondary level right now have a chance to see what their options would be after secondary school and we are hoping that a good number of them at least will choose to further their education in tertiary education. Our participation at the tertiary level is low and we think that a lot of it is because people don't always understand just how much actually is possible. People think that it can't happen or it is too expensive, yes there is a cost to it and it is not a small cost but we think that with a combination of scholarships and financial assistance and bank loans and there is DFC in there so the message is that these are the options and these are the opportunities check the possibilities."
